Output 4bab1bf80b30bed4f20ed4e02ad25c07aa2327573b264f85c6a9edb42ea35094:0

value
670000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6517b195eed34b5ae8ee95d7829b9e9ee2c1b3a0 OP_EQUALVERIFY OP_CHECKSIG
address
bMwoKsYpMPesF7HcGTsmnS4YuDbAx316mH
transaction
4bab1bf80b30bed4f20ed4e02ad25c07aa2327573b264f85c6a9edb42ea35094